smart-logo.pngCar Key Replacement Cost

Replacing your car key could be costly. It is possible to have the cost of replacing your car keys covered by Key Protection Covers that you can purchase as an additional item to your insurance plan or as a separate product.

The cost of replacing your car keys depends on the model, year and model of your vehicle. In this article, we'll look at the factors that affect the cost of replacing your car keys.

What is the make and model of your vehicle?

It's always a pain to lose your keys to your car however, it's a lot more troublesome when you don’t have spare keys. In most cases, if you want to get back in your car you'll require a new set of keys. However, the key for your car replacement cost may vary dependent on the specific car you own. Modern cars come with a broad range of features that can make it more expensive to replace your keys. For instance, high-performance sports cars often come with specialized keys that can be costly to duplicate.

It's also more costly to duplicate the older mechanical key systems because they require the knowledge of a dealer in order to work. Therefore, it's essential to know your car's model and make before requesting an estimate from a locksmith or auto dealership. This way, you can expect a fair price estimate.

The complexity of your key system can influence the cost. For instance, modern key fobs have a battery and electronic circuitry, making them more complicated to replace than keys that were made in the past.

The Automotive Locksmith You Use

If you've ever locked the keys to your car inside, it's a headache nobody wants to tackle. This scenario can occur at the worst time possible, such as when you are in a hurry to attend an important event or meeting. You can call an auto locksmith for a fast and affordable solution, instead of rushing to the dealership to get.

Car keys and FOBs have circuitry, as well as a specific transponder chips that must be programmed in order to start the car. In the past the chips were placed in the ignition cylinder. As technology advanced, the chips were moved to the keyfobs. The key fobs were upgraded to be more secure and harder to duplicate. However the cost of repairs and replacements grew due to the fact that the new key fobs needed to be programmed by an automotive locksmith or by a dealer.

Fortunately, a lot of locksmiths for cars have adapted and learned how to work with these newer systems. They can program new FOBs to work with your vehicle, or take out the old ones if they do not work. The cost of this service can vary depending on the year, make, and model of your vehicle.

The kind of key you require also affects the cost. There are two types of car keys that most automobiles use: a traditional metal key that isn't connected to a fob or any other electrical component, and a remote FOB that controls the ignition and unlocks or unlocks the doors. The latter is usually the cheapest to replace since it does not require programming and can be cut by an automotive locksmith using a special blank.

The second type of key is more expensive to replace because it requires a special transponder chip to unlock the car. The Kind of Key You Are Looking For

There are a variety of car keys. Some are mechanical and just require insertion into the ignition cylinder while others include transponders that can unlock doors or start the engine from some distance. The cost of replacing the latter type is higher since it requires programming by a professional for your vehicle. Locksmiths have adapted to the new technology, which means you don't need to visit a dealership to get one of these keys made.

The Location

Car keys are miniature electronic devices that have batteries and circuitry. They also come with a transmitter that sends a code to the car to open its doors and begin the engine. They can be costly to replace in the event you lose or break them. The cost for car key replacement of the actual key is typically not too much, but the work required to cut and program the new car key replacement key for your particular vehicle is what can add up. These costs can vary widely dependent on the type and complexity of the key as well as the locksmith or dealer you choose to make it.

The location of your house could also impact the price of the new car key. For instance, if reside in a rural area, there might be fewer auto locksmiths to assist you with your problem. This means you'll need to pay more for their services, because they'll have to travel longer distances to get to you. On the other hand when you live in a city like Chicago there are likely to be a variety of locksmiths for automotive to choose from, so you can find one that offers competitive prices for their services.
